Do Not Ignore Your Local Postcard Shows
1 Attachment(s)
Postcard dealers do know that some baseball postcards are valuable, but for the most part they do not have a clue what they're selling. I picked up a lot of great stuff at the Omaha Postcard and Paper show today...including a 1913 Superior minor league postcard with Dazzy Vance. Picked up a bunch of boxing/golf/football postcards out of dealer's bargain boxes as well.

This Omaha show is very small...probably only 15 dealers...nearly every one of them has a topical section which includes sports...almost all of them included baseball. And I've found postcard dealers much more willing to deal than card dealers. I'll admit this is my best score in 5 years of attending this show, but persistence pays off. All of the cards below were purchased for less than $4 each..and in some cases were found in the 50 cent box.
